What is a remote timeshare call center?

A remote timeshare call center is a team of customer service or sales agents who work from home or remote locations, handling phone calls related to timeshare properties. These agents assist customers with inquiries about timeshare ownership, booking, payments, or issues, and may also conduct sales or marketing calls to potential buyers. The remote setup allows flexible work arrangements and can help companies provide support across different time zones. Common tasks include answering questions, resolving problems, and providing information about vacation packages or promotions. Remote timeshare call centers often use specialized software to manage calls, track customer interactions, and ensure quality service.

What is the difference between Remote Timeshare Call Center vs Remote Vacation Sales Agent?

AspectRemote Timeshare Call CenterRemote Vacation Sales Agent
CredentialsCustomer service experience, sales skillsSales experience, communication skills
Work EnvironmentCall center setting, inbound/outbound callsRemote, direct sales calls with clients
Industry UsageTimeshare industry, hospitalityTravel and vacation packages
Job FocusHandling timeshare inquiries and salesPromoting vacation packages and closing sales

While both roles involve sales and customer interaction in the travel industry, a Remote Timeshare Call Center primarily handles timeshare inquiries and sales within a call center environment. In contrast, a Remote Vacation Sales Agent focuses on selling vacation packages directly to clients, often with more flexibility and varied sales approaches. Understanding these differences helps job seekers find the role that best matches their skills and career goals.

What are some common challenges faced by agents working in a remote timeshare call center and how can they be addressed?

Agents in remote timeshare call centers often face challenges such as handling high call volumes, maintaining motivation while working independently, and managing difficult customer objections. Staying organized with time management tools, participating in regular virtual team meetings, and leveraging training resources can help agents stay connected and effective. Building strong communication skills and seeking feedback from supervisors also play a key role in overcoming these challenges and ensuring success in the remote environment.
